Navin Fluorine International standalone net profit declines 6.73% in the March 2017 quarter

Sales rise 5.79% to Rs 200.53 crore

Net profit of Navin Fluorine International declined 6.73% to Rs 29.38 crore in the quarter ended March 2017 as against Rs 31.50 crore during the previous quarter ended March 2016. Sales rose 5.79% to Rs 200.53 crore in the quarter ended March 2017 as against Rs 189.55 crore during the previous quarter ended March 2016.

For the full year,net profit rose 54.99% to Rs 134.02 crore in the year ended March 2017 as against Rs 86.47 crore during the previous year ended March 2016. Sales rose 10.21% to Rs 701.23 crore in the year ended March 2017 as against Rs 636.24 crore during the previous year ended March 2016.
